matlab绘制条形图时,怎样设置横坐标,绘制出横坐标为距离范围,纵坐标为统计数量的条形图我的代码如下:x=0:1400:14000;A=zeros(154,154);for t=1:10 for i=1:154 for j=1:154 if Dis(i,j)>=x(t) &am

来源:学生作业帮助网 编辑:作业帮 时间:2024/10/04 19:10:17
matlab绘制条形图时,怎样设置横坐标,绘制出横坐标为距离范围,纵坐标为统计数量的条形图我的代码如下:x=0:1400:14000;A=zeros(154,154);for t=1:10    for i=1:154        for j=1:154            if Dis(i,j)>=x(t) &am
xUkoP+ Ćh;e1--PRil3sN`vE(p3ɿ9e0vAbOs{{MSyɊ^wn}:[g1.yu^sgTN*uԽla|vvx?[/~,K`bAoiiA+MX>xX,t$q,v*{Yft׉l$R"XX'o^?Ȝi,MS&yr!r| 131B=bIV b55Q4 %<,cbxQE@Ja3ѬKƪP-~-(*)2O'c1YUPR4æ(jZ`Pn D k< d pA18v~ qmvDxiăTd DnjLo$c'.zb3+B)Ө \0; (p  "B 877B2?Za$ #;v>ﻍ3jKrZ/zVC| ݍݱ#:Fp@ݴ2A?x?ܵۋ*|4y Go'Hc*/'2vt`#xn}O^i5N}q]kvwiȅ)_2^X

matlab绘制条形图时,怎样设置横坐标,绘制出横坐标为距离范围,纵坐标为统计数量的条形图我的代码如下:x=0:1400:14000;A=zeros(154,154);for t=1:10 for i=1:154 for j=1:154 if Dis(i,j)>=x(t) &am
matlab绘制条形图时,怎样设置横坐标,绘制出横坐标为距离范围,纵坐标为统计数量的条形图

我的代码如下:

x=0:1400:14000;
A=zeros(154,154);
for t=1:10
    for i=1:154
        for j=1:154
            if Dis(i,j)>=x(t) && Dis(i,j)<=x(t+1)
                A(i,j)=1;
            else
                A(i,j)=0;
            end
        end
        y(t)=length(find(A>0));
        %axis([[0,1400,2800,4200,5600,7000,8400,9800,11200,12600,14000]]);
        xlabel('距离范围');
        ylabel('合作学校数量');
        title('不同地理距离范围下,合作院校数量');
        %bar(x(t),y(t));
        bar(hist(x,10),y(t));
    end
end
为什么不能实现条形图的绘制

matlab绘制条形图时,怎样设置横坐标,绘制出横坐标为距离范围,纵坐标为统计数量的条形图我的代码如下:x=0:1400:14000;A=zeros(154,154);for t=1:10 for i=1:154 for j=1:154 if Dis(i,j)>=x(t) &am
请把Dis这个函数的代码贴上来,我们好帮你找问题